Plant: Ginger (Zingiber officinale)

 

Special features of 6-gingerol:

  • Has an anticarcinogenic, anti-inflammatory and immunosuppressive effect
  • 6-Gingerol has a positive effect on asthmatic diseases
  • Could interfere with the development of tumors

6-Gingerol inhibits the expression of the cyclooxygenase-2 enzyme which is responsible for inflammation in osteoarthritis and rheumatism.
